Access All Messages in Newsgroup

I am using Windows Mail to view newsgroups. I have found that with Windows
Mail, I do not have access to all of the messages that are actually in that
newsgroup. This becomes a problem when I search that newsgroup for a
particular message. It will only search the messages that I have access to
in Windows Mail rather than the entire database of messages that are in that
newsgroup. For example, in newsgroup:
microsoft.public.windowsxp.security_admin, I have 287 messages showing but I
know there are many hundreds more. They just don't show up in my system. My
question is: How can I get access to all the messages in the newsgroup when
using Windows Mail as my newsreader.
